Job Description

  • Lead planning, budgeting, and scheduling for commercial construction projects from preconstruction through closeout.
  • Coordinate architects, engineers, subcontractors, and suppliers to ensure project scope and specifications are met.
  • Monitor project costs, manage change orders, and maintain financial control against the approved budget.
  • Oversee site progress and ensure milestones are achieved according to the project schedule.
  • Ensure compliance with safety regulations, building codes, permits, and quality standards.
  • Communicate regularly with clients and stakeholders to provide updates, resolve issues, and manage expectations.
  • Identify project risks and implement mitigation strategies to prevent delays or cost overruns.
  • Review contracts, manage procurement, and ensure subcontractor performance and deliverables meet project requirements.
